Ethics

The goal of the Ethics program at the Brant Community Healthcare System (BCHS) is to build ethics capacity and nurture a culture that helps us "do the right thing" when engaging in providing healthcare and doing healthcare research.

What is Ethics?

Ethics is the systematic examination of facts, beliefs, standards and values in determining the rightness or wrongness of decisions and actions. Ethics involves expanding our focus from what is good for me, to consider "the greater good." Ethics is not merely having an opinion or gut reaction, but involves reasoned deliberation to address the question: "What is the best thing to do, all things considered?"
